Classification and technical standards of sanitary products
1. Ceramic bathroom
- Raw material process:
- Kaolin (Al₂O₃ content>28%) Quartz sand Feldspar mix
- 1280°C high-temperature firing (water absorption rate <0.5% is excellent)
2. Smart bathroom
- Core module cost structure:
- Ceramic body (35%)> heating block (25%)> control board (20%)
- Waterproof Rating:
- The control panel needs to be IPX4
- The bottom motor compartment needs to be IPX6

2. Breakthrough in glaze technology
- Nano self-cleaning glaze: TiO₂ photocatalytic decomposition of organic matter
- Antimicrobial silver ion glaze: antimicrobial rate > 99% (ISO 22196)
- Microcrystalline glaze: 7 on the Mohs scale (5 for ordinary glaze)

1. Wall-Hung Toilet
Advantages: space-saving, easy to clean, modern look
Installation Points:
Embedded steel frame is required (load-bearing capacity of more than 400kg)
The height of the wall drain is recommended to be 220-300mm
Applicable wall: concrete or reinforced brick wall
